Torksey Lock is a sought-after waterside location set along the River Trent and the Fossdyke Navigation, offering a peaceful lifestyle surrounded by open countryside and scenic waterways. Popular with walkers, cyclists, boaters, and those who simply enjoy a quieter pace of life, the area is known for its tranquil atmosphere, beautiful views, and friendly community feel.

Despite its rural setting, Torksey Lock is well placed for access to nearby villages and towns, with road links to Lincoln, Gainsborough, and Newark providing a wider range of amenities, schooling, and services.
